Challenges in Waste Management
Global waste generation is expected to reach 3.4 billion metric tons by 2050, according to recent studies. Municipalities, hospitals, and disaster relief operations face numerous challenges in managing their waste effectively while adhering to environmental guidelines. Conventional methods often fall short in mobility, capacity, and thermal efficiency, leading to increased carbon footprints and safety hazards.

1. Emergency Response in Remote Areas
In scenarios such as natural disasters, the rapid disposal of waste can prevent the spread of disease. A reported case in the Philippines during Typhoon Haiyan highlighted how portable incinerators were deployed by NGOs to manage medical waste generated from field hospitals effectively. The mobility and efficiency of the incinerator allowed for timely disposal while ensuring environmental compliance.
